Hepatitis A vaccine highly effective

Hepatitis A outbreaks in all age groups could be prevented if children are routinely vaccinated against it.Hepatitis is an inflammation of the liver cells either due to a viral infection of the liver or injury caused by a chemical toxin. Infection by Hepatitis A virus (HAV) is the common in children and the virus is excreted in the stools of infected individuals. The infection is acquired when someone eats food that is contaminated with HAV-infected stool. the virus passes into the body. It spreads easily in unsanitary living conditions through contaminated water, milk and food. The illness is usually characterized by transient, flu-like symptoms and jaundice, and recovery is the norm in most cases. Persons living in the same household as an infected person have a high risk of infection. Infection in children may be asymptomatic, but they can be very efficient transmitters of the disease to adults. A study was conducted among nearly 44,982 children aged 2 to 17 years in Butte County, California from January 1995 to December 2000. They reported that of these children, about 29,789 (66.2%) received at least 1 vaccine dose and of these about 17,681 (39.3%) received a second dose. The number of hepatitis A cases in the US population declined by 93.5% during the study period, from 57 cases in 1995 to 4 in 2000, the lowest number of cases reported since hepatitis A surveillance began. In this population, hepatitis A vaccine was highly effective in preventing disease among recipients.Childhood vaccination decreases hepatitis A incidence among children and adults. Hepatitis A vaccinations made available to children in schools, clinics and day care centres can reduce the number of hepatitis A cases suggesting that routine vaccination of children may be highly effective in preventing the disease. Routine vaccination of children can reduce overall disease rates in the community, and vaccination should be offered as a routine to all people who can afford it.
JAMA Dec 2001, Vol. 286:23
